Description: Position Summary

The Restaurant Manager is responsible for the overall leadership, operational execution, and financial performance of Vinarosa Resort’s restaurant and bar outlets. This role ensures a consistently exceptional guest experience through the delivery of refined service standards, thoughtful hospitality, and strong team leadership. The Restaurant Manager oversees front-of-house operations while partnering closely with culinary and beverage leaders to ensure alignment between service, menu execution, and brand positioning. Responsibilities include labor management, training and development, service recovery, and adherence to all food safety and responsible alcohol service requirements. The position plays a key role in driving revenue, controlling costs, and maintaining operational efficiency. Through visible leadership and accountability, the Restaurant Manager contributes to guest loyalty, team engagement, and long-term asset value.

Key Responsibilities

· Oversee daily restaurant and bar operations to ensure service excellence and operational consistency

· Lead, coach, and develop front-of-house leadership and service teams

· Ensure adherence to luxury brand service standards, policies, and procedures

· Manage labor scheduling, staffing levels, and productivity to meet business needs

· Monitor service pacing, guest flow, and table turns to optimize revenue performance

· Lead service recovery efforts and personally address elevated guest concerns

· Collaborate with culinary and beverage leaders on menu execution and guest experience

· Ensure compliance with food safety, sanitation, and responsible alcohol service regulations

· Oversee opening, closing, and shift transition procedures

· Monitor operating costs and support inventory awareness and cost controls

· Support recruitment, onboarding, and ongoing training initiatives

· Review guest feedback and operational metrics to drive continuous improvement

· Document incidents, performance issues, and operational matters as required

· Partner with senior leadership on special events, promotions, and initiatives

Requirements: Required Skills & Qualifications

· Previous restaurant management experience in a hotel or upscale dining environment required

· Strong knowledge of food and beverage operations and service standards

· Proven leadership, communication, and team development skills

· Experience managing labor, budgets, and operational performance

· Proficiency with POS systems and reporting tools

· Working knowledge of food safety and alcohol service regulations

Physical & Scheduling Requirements

This position requires standing and walking for extended periods and the ability to support service operations as needed. Flexible availability is required, including evenings, weekends, holidays, and special events.

Work Environment Statement

The work environment includes indoor and outdoor restaurant and bar venues within a luxury resort setting. Employees may be exposed to varying noise levels, temperatures, and high guest volumes.
